FEES
​
The Australian Psychological Society National Schedule of Recommended Fees for 2024-2025, has the standard 46 to 60-minute consultation fee at $311.
https://psychology.org.au/psychology/about-psychology/what-it-costs/private-practice-services
​
The Australian Association of Psychologists Inc, Recommended Fees for 2025-2026, has the standard 46 to 60-minute consultation fee at $330.
​
Lisa Mulhall Psychology offers affordable treatment options well below the recommended fee. We believe that financial hardship should not become a barrier to accessing psychological support and treatment. This is why we currently only offer online Telehealth sessions which helps keep fees down due to low overheads.

Initial Appointment Fee = $185 per session
​
This first appointment involves a detailed history taking, assessment of needs and formulation of treatment goals. This is the opportunity for you to get to know your psychologist and determine if there is a good fit as well as ask any questions you have about different treatment modalities and what will be suitable e.g EMDR or another treatment option.
A referral acknowledgement letter is also sent to your referring GP if you have a current Mental Health Care Plan (MHCP).
After paying the full fee at the time of consultation via secure online processing, you can also receive a Medicare Rebate of $96.65 (As of 1st July 2025 this rebate increases to $98.95) per session if you have a valid MHCP from a GP. (This is to be arranged before the first session takes place and is usually valid for 6 sessions up to a total of 10 sessions per year with GP approval).
​
Ongoing Appointment Fee = $165 per session
​
After paying the full fee at the time of consultation via secure online processing you can also receive a Medicare Rebate of $96.65
(As of 1st July 2025 this rebate increases to $98.95) per session if you have a valid MHCP from a GP.

WorkCover and CTP
​
Lisa Mulhall Psychology is approved to provide Psychological treatment for those eligible under WorkCover and CTP in NSW, QLD, VIC, WA and SA. The State Insurance Regulatory Authority (SIRA) covers the cost of these sessions. Please provide your claim number and insurance representative contact details (name, email and phone number) in the booking form to arrange an appointment. If these details are not provided at the time of booking you will be responsible for paying the session fee on the day and claiming the costs back from your insurer. Please note the Fee's for WorkCover are different from our Standard Fee's listed above so please be aware of this if you decide you would like to pay yourself and get reimbursed by your insurer as Lisa Mulhall Psychology does not liaise with Workcover or provide reports to those who are paying Standard Fee's or under Bulk Billing.
